Window sill repair

Although window sills might not be the most noticeable part, they are still an essential part of a home's aesthetic. They're also extremely exposed to the elements, so they can easily get damaged. There are many ways to repair window sills. The first step is to assess the damage. Examine for any splits or cracks that extend beyond the surface. Small gaps can be filled with wood glue but larger ones will need to be replaced. Check if there are any large concrete chunks missing.

This usually indicates that there is a bigger problem that needs more extensive repairs or replacing. For instance, if cracks have gotten larger and there are large chunks missing, it might be time to consider replacing the whole window sill.

It is essential to have the right tools available before you begin. To take off the old sill, you'll need an utility knife, putty knives, a mallet or hammer, the pry-bar, and a chisel. To avoid damaging the window frame it's best to be cautious.

After removing the old sill, it is important to clean any rot or mould that might have formed on the frame. If you don't get rid of it then it will continue to grow and cause damage. Use a paint scraper to remove any caulk that has been damaged.

Then, you need to apply a new coat of paint to the window sill. You can also fill any remaining gaps with window spray foam to guarantee an airtight seal. Make use of a sander and paper sandpaper to smooth the surface of your sill.

The most popular material used for window sills is wood, but some are constructed of tile or stone. Sills made of wood can be painted or stained in order to ensure they are more resistant to the elements. Tile and stone sills on the other hand, are more durable and do not require special care. Regardless of the material, it's important to keep your windowsills in good condition to prevent water damage and other issues.

Window frame repair

The frames, sills, and windows' sashes are essential elements of a home. They hold the glass in place, and act as insulation. However, they can become damaged or worn out over time. These issues can cause mould, draughts, and other issues, and they need to be repaired as quickly as is possible.

Check the frames and sills for any damage. Also, look for signs of moisture or decay. If you see any, you should contact a professional for repairs as soon as you can. The longer you wait the worse it'll get.

Moisture around window frames as well as in walls can cause rot. This isn't only ugly, but it's also an health risk for those with respiratory conditions and asthma. Moisture may also cause leaks that are difficult to detect. It could be due to leaks in another area of the house or due to faulty window frames.

It's a great idea stain or paint your wood frames regularly. This will allow them to withstand the elements and increase their lifespan. It is also important to check for damage regularly and replace the hardware if necessary. Consult a professional if notice that your windows are stuck or have trouble opening and closing.

Over the years, most wooden windows will require maintenance. This could include fixing cracks or splits. They are also affected by the elements, specifically heat and sun. Wood is prone to rot and insect damage It is recommended to have it repaired or replaced as soon as you notice any damage.

Repairing wooden window frames can be expensive, but it's often cheaper than replacing them. The cost of a window repair depends on the extent of damage, and the materials that were used. A repair job for wooden windows typically cost between $175 and $300 for a window. Repairs on aluminum frames are less expensive, however they are still prone to damage over the years. They could be damaged by cracks or bent from exposure to temperature changes and can result in loss of sealant which is necessary for weatherproofing.

French door repair

French doors are a stunning addition to any home. They offer an unobstructed view of the outside while allowing plenty of sunlight into the living space. Like all windows and doors, they are vulnerable to damage due to weather conditions and wear and tear. It is essential to address these issues as soon as you can. They could range from minor issues to major ones. Fortunately, the majority of repairs are simple and cost-effective.

The most common problem with french doors is that they don't close properly. This could be due to a number of things, including misalignment or inadequate installation. To resolve the issue, close the door and check for any obstructions that may hinder it from closing. Then, align the door and close it once more to ensure it is working properly.

The latch can also become stuck on french doors. This can be frustrating because it can stop doors from opening or closed. You can fix this problem by re-lubricating the lock or replacing the latch. If you're not confident working on your French door, it is recommended to contact a professional.

Lastly, French doors can become damaged by decay or moisture. This happens when the finish of the wood deteriorates and allows moisture into the pores. This could cause the wood to expand and contract, which results in rotting. If left untreated, the rot may spread to other areas of the wood. However, this kind of damage isn't always irreparable and can be treated by using a resin glue that penetrates the wood and then dries hard as glass.
